Application of the background subtraction method and Viola-Jones algorithm for increasing the speed of face tracking in the personality recognition system

https://doi.org/10.23947/2587-8999-2018-2-1-25-32

Abstract

Existing method of automatic tracking of moving objects in the video stream in real time is described in the paper in relation to the task of person’s recognition from his face image. A method of face tracking in the video stream based on a combination of the background subtraction method and the Viola-Jones algorithm for the face area detection in the frame and reducing requirements for computing resources of person’s recognition systems is proposed. Results of testing the proposed face tracking algorithm in the video stream are shown.
